eSports (or electronic sport) is competitive video-gaming which often includes multiplayer game competitions between individuals or teams. eSports provides a meaningful skills-development and growth opportunity including strategy, research and media literacy, collaboration, self-management, leadership, interpersonal skills, conflict resolution, communication, creativity and more.
